29 September 1997 – Subject To Change
Alpha Instruction Set
A–3
Alpha Instruction Summary
CMOVGE
Opr
11.46
CMOVE if
≥
zero
CMOVGT
Opr
11.66
CMOVE if > zero
CMOVLBC
Opr
11.16
CMOVE if low bit clear
CMOVLBS
Opr
11.14
CMOVE if low bit set
CMOVLE
Opr
11.64
CMOVE if
≤
zero
CMOVLT
Opr
11.44
CMOVE if < zero
CMOVNE
Opr
11.26
CMOVE if
≠
zero
CMPBGE
Opr
10.0F
Compare byte
CMPEQ
Opr
10.2D
Compare signed quadword equal
CMPGEQ
F-P
15.0A5
Compare G_floating equal
CMPGLE
F-P
15.0A7
Compare G_floating less than or equal
CMPGLT
F-P
15.0A6
Compare G_floating less than
CMPLE
Opr
10.6D
Compare signed quadword less than or equal
CMPLT
Opr
10.4D
Compare signed quadword less than
CMPTEQ
F-P
16.0A5
Compare T_floating equal
CMPTLE
F-P
16.0A7
Compare T_floating less than or equal
CMPTLT
F-P
16.0A6
Compare T_floating less than
CMPTUN
F-P
16.0A4
Compare T_floating unordered
CMPULE
Opr
10.3D
Compare unsigned quadword less than or equal
CMPULT
Opr
10.1D
Compare unsigned quadword less than
CPYS
F-P
17.020
Copy sign
CPYSE
F-P
17.022
Copy sign and exponent
CPYSN
F-P
17.021
Copy sign negate
CVTDG
F-P
15.09E
Convert D_floating to G_floating
CVTGD
F-P
15.0AD
Convert G_floating to D_floating
CVTGF
F-P
15.0AD
Convert G_floating to F_floating
Table A–2 Architecture Instructions
(Sheet 2 of 8)
Mnemonic
Format
Opcode
Description